Retailing of a product is very important to an MLM business. Lack of (or even non-existing) retailing could be harmful to the distributor or the company as certain states have outlawed ‘headhunting’ and have their own policies.
Nevertheless, saving money on an MLM product is one of the most wonderful key features of joining an MLM company if recruiting is not your forte.
In certain compensation plans, repeat purchase of the products you buy from the company gives you more rebates or bonuses. In essence, the more you buy, the cheaper it becomes. This becomes an even greater pleasure if you are totally in love with the products or you have already set aside a budget for those products (which means you are now buying from the MLM company or your upline instead of buying from the supermarket, pharmacy, grocery store, etc)
There are some important aspects to take note however, if the company requires you to purchase the products in bulk (hence the term – frontloading), is there a DEMOTION in your achieved position in the company, is there MAINTAINANCE required, or how much are the renewal fees for membership. Making Money
(a) Looking for fast money
(b) Building a long term business with money coming in long after you have ‘retired’
(c) Investing in the product itself
For people looking for fast money, there are pros and cons to this kind of thinking.
Some people are WELL TRAINED salesmen. They have built the relationship with their clients, customers and all sorts of people. People trust what they say and will trust whatever they are selling. They may sell the product itself (sometimes, in large quantities), or they may sell the opportunity (the money making part of it) or both. Are YOU this kind of person?
Fast money is not impossible, but it COULD be for the short term only. Consider the facts that 80-90% of people in the world are NOT built for sales. If a salesman sponsors a non-salesman, would the non-salesman be able to do the same thing as his upline? Does that mean that I would spend most of my time looking for the 10-20% of sales types?
The next type of money is the long term type.
When I define long term, it does not have to mean that you might not see money right away. It differs from company to company. But as a general rule of thumb, it involves BUILDING A NETWORK OR AN ORGANISATION.
The key to building a large organization as quoted by Zig Ziglar, “You will get whatever you want in life if you will just help enough other people get what they want.” In other words, if you will help enough downlines get enough downlines, you are on the road to network marketing financial freedom. The key is to help others.
